G Collado S.A.B. de C.V (COLLADO)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io
G Collado S.A.B. de C.V (COLLADO)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of 67.3% as of December 2019. Working capital of MX$865.17 Million (current assets of MX$2.82 Billion minus current liabilities of MX$1.96 Billion) is measured against net assets of MX$1.29 Billion. A higher ratio indicates strong short-term liquidity financed by the equity base. Annual Working Capital to Net Assets for G Collado S.A.B. de C.V (2013–2019)
The table below presents the year-by-year Working Capital to Net Assets ratio for G Collado S.A.B. de C.V from 2013 to 2019, covering 7 annual filings. Each row shows current assets, current liabilities, working capital, net assets, the ratio,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. | Year | WC/NA Ratio | Working Capital (MXN) | Net Assets | Current Assets | Current Liabilities | Change (pp)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 67.3% | MX$865.17 Million | MX$1.29 Billion | MX$2.82 Billion | MX$1.96 Billion | ▼ -24.8 pp |
| 2018 | 92.1% | MX$1.17 Billion | MX$1.27 Billion | MX$3.65 Billion | MX$2.48 Billion | ▼ -16.4 pp |
| 2017 | 108.5% | MX$1.25 Billion | MX$1.16 Billion | MX$3.08 Billion | MX$1.83 Billion | ▼ -1.1 pp |
| 2016 | 109.5% | MX$1.09 Billion | MX$995.39 Million | MX$3.09 Billion | MX$2.00 Billion | ▼ -4.5 pp |
| 2015 | 114.0% | MX$994.73 Million | MX$872.73 Million | MX$2.03 Billion | MX$1.04 Billion | ▲ +7.2 pp |
| 2014 | 106.8% | MX$999.10 Million | MX$935.83 Million | MX$2.11 Billion | MX$1.12 Billion | ▼ -25.3 pp |
| 2013 | 132.0% | MX$1.29 Billion | MX$975.07 Million | MX$2.01 Billion | MX$721.35 Million | — |
